Output 663921dca99655bebaa78f019110e44cd23aa4384c8f41bc2583dbd356817429:19

value
1468629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d2116e6e556b384ee7928d34b3bf0bbc235e160 OP_EQUALVERIFY OP_CHECKSIG
address
1JF2MMR5JSViegczXTRftHdiM5J8ZRGCBN
transaction
663921dca99655bebaa78f019110e44cd23aa4384c8f41bc2583dbd356817429
confirmations
204786
spent
true